Wolfram Reviews

Wolfram has an overall rating of 3.9 based on 29 reviews. Customer feedback on Wolfram is mixed: Wolfram reviewers highlight positive aspects like powerful computational capabilities, extensive knowledge base, user-friendly interface and responsive customer support, which strongly appeal to students, educators, researchers and professionals in STEM fields. However, Wolfram is often criticized for its steep learning curve, high subscription cost, occasional performance issues and limited offline functionality.
